A “verified” firmware update means the file is official, uncorrupted, and compatible with your specific hardware version. It means the source is trusted (either Tenda’s official portal or a reliable regional server), and the file has passed hash checks (like MD5 or SHA256). Without verification, you risk turning your reliable router into an expensive paperweight.
